I think I can help provide a little context, or at least some verification, regarding this group of shots from Sunland. I grew up in North Glendale/La Crescenta, but Sunland was within my stomping grounds, and along one of my family's migratory routes.
First, I can confirm that although I don't recall the amusement park, from the surrounding areas shown in that group of pictures, that was almost certainly in Sunland Park, along the Foothill Blvd. side.
Second, I remember that Sunland sign just barely, although I would say it was gone most likely by 1966 or 1967, and definitely by 1970.
